Hydroxyapatite Deposition Disease (HADD)

Hydroxyapatite Deposition Disease (HADD) is a condition characterized by the abnormal accumulation of hydroxyapatite crystals in soft tissues, particularly around joints and tendons, leading to inflammation and pain. Clinically, it is significant as it can mimic other musculoskeletal disorders, potentially delaying appropriate treatment. A common association is calcific tendinitis, often affecting the shoulder, which can result in significant functional impairment if not addressed.
